The New York Mets (17-18) visit the Cincinnati Reds (14-20) on Tuesday to start a three-game series, with the first pitch at 6:40 PM ET from Great American Ball Park. The Mets are listed as -164 favorites, while the underdog Reds have +138 odds on the moneyline.

David Peterson starts for New York while Luke Weaver is Cincinnati’s starter for the contest.

Mets and Reds Betting Trends

The Mets have a 13-12 record in games they were listed as the moneyline favorite (winning 52% of those games).

New York has a 6-6 record (winning 50% of its games) when playing as moneyline favorites of -164 or shorter.

The Reds have entered the game as underdogs 23 times this season and won eight, or 34.8%, of those games.

Cincinnati has a record of 2-9 in games where oddsmakers have it as underdogs of at least +138 on the moneyline.

The Mets have played in 35 games with set over/under, and have combined with opponents to go over the total 15 times (15-19-1).

So far this season, the Reds and their opponents have hit the over in 18 of their 34 games with a total.

Mets Stats & Insights

The Mets have the No. 18 offense in MLB play scoring 4.3 runs per game (150 total runs).

New York ranks 22nd in MLB play with 36 home runs. They average one per game.

The Mets rank 22nd in the majors with a .236 batting average.

New York strikes out 7.7 times per game, the third-best average in MLB.

The Mets pitching staff ranks 17th in MLB with a collective 8.6 strikeouts per nine innings.

New York has the 22nd-ranked team ERA among all MLB pitching staffs (4.74).

Reds Stats & Insights

The Reds have scored 144 runs (4.2 per game) this season, which ranks 25th in MLB.

Cincinnati’s 27 home runs rank 28th in MLB this season.

The Reds have a team batting average of .246 this season, which ranks 15th among MLB teams.

Cincinnati ranks 13th in strikeouts per game (nine) among MLB offenses.

The Reds average 9.4 strikeouts per nine innings as a pitching staff, sixth-most in the league.

Cincinnati has pitched to a 5.20 ERA this season, which ranks 27th in baseball.

Mets Key Players to Watch

Peterson gets the call to start for the Mets, his first this season.

Pete Alonso leads New York in home runs (11) and runs batted in (29) this season while batting .235.

Brandon Nimmo leads New York in batting with a .310 average while slugging three homers and driving in 14 runs.

Francisco Lindor is slashing .217/.320/.426 this season for the Mets.

Jeff McNeil is batting .289 with an OBP of .394 and a slugging percentage of .405 this season.

Reds Key Players to Watch

The Reds will hand the ball to Weaver (0-2) for his fourth start of the season.

Jonathan India is batting .306 with 10 doubles, three home runs and 17 walks.

TJ Friedl has a club-best .319 batting average.

Spencer Steer has hit a team-best four homers.

Jake Fraley has totaled 18 runs batted in to lead his team.
